"Red Bull is New Owner, and Name, of MetroStars" (emphasis all ours), in the New York Times. That's right, the Major League Soccer team known as the New York/New Jersey MetroStars will now be named after an energy drink -- Red Bull New York (If you don't believe us, visit the team's already-updated Web site). The Times reports that Red Bull paid in excess of $100 million for the MLS team, a share in a new stadium yet to be built and naming rights.
